Job Description

● Load and perform data validation procedures/checklist for performance data on assigned programs and data migrations. ● Execute quantitative analyses that translate data into actionable insights; provide analytical and data-driven decision-making support for key projects. ● Document data processing and data validation procedures for all assigned programs. ● Develop and automate reports, solving for the Business Intelligence and analytical needs of our full range of stakeholders working with function leads and other stakeholders to establish the right metrics for monitoring the business. ● Pull and model data from our data lake to create quantitative models of business trends and measure impact of online sales growth initiatives. ● Create dashboards and reports that provide analysis and commentary, explaining product, sales, and business trends for Executive reporting. ● Work closely with product and inform and update stakeholders on product performance, plans, and progress towards metrics. ● Generate and go deep on consumer insights and competitive intelligence to help teams drive product innovation and iteration. ● Work with Sales Operations, Business Intelligence, Marketing and other stakeholders to establish the right metrics for monitoring their businesses. ● Produce accurate and timely reports both online and offline. ● Communicate insights in compelling ways, creating data story telling. ● Develop automated and reusable routines for extracting requested information.

Requirements

● 2-4 years of experience in data analysis and data management. ● BS in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ics or related technical discipline. ● Background or previous experience in analytics and / or marketing experience a plus. ● Hands-on experience with SQL, dash-boarding and reporting, involving datasets and multiple data sources. ● Demonstrated track record of creating and building complex evaluation tools for assessing/tracking product performance and learning associated user behaviors. ● Hands-on experience in software development methodologies and working knowledge in Java and other programming languages preferable (Scala, JavaScript, Shell, Perl, Python, R, C/C++) ● Experience with analytical tools supporting data evaluation and reporting, as well as querying large, complex data sets (Tableau, PwerBI, SQL, R, etc) ● Demonstrated use of analytics, metrics, and bench-marking to drive decisions ● Hands on experience with A/B testing, statistical analysis, and/or insights. ● Highly analytical, with a track record of being a strong problem solver; capable of translating data into meaningful analysis and insights, presenting to business stakeholders, and driving value for the business. Ability to see the big picture and to focus on details when necessary. ● Proven track record of project management and organizational skills, with an ability to initiate, prioritize, and execute complex, cross-functional projects with minimal guidance across businesses and leadership levels. ● Ability to explain the experiment tracking needs that should be implemented/developed to both business and technical counterparts, and to identify, troubleshoot and resolve data quality issues. ● Proactive problem solver with professional and intellectual credibility and an impact style.
